Nov 10 23:17:24 obr so we do not have any reasons other than additional effort to compile & test on panther, do we ?
Nov 10 23:17:36 obr to drop Tiger I mean
Nov 10 23:17:52 shaunmcdonald obr: s/Tiger/Panther
Nov 10 23:17:54 paveljanik obr: we do not have environment to test on it.
Nov 10 23:18:08 paveljanik gcc-3.3 is buggy in several aspects
Nov 10 23:18:13 paveljanik reject valid code
Nov 10 23:18:24 obr shaunmcdonald: thanks :-)
Nov 10 23:18:25 paveljanik doesn't support all warnings
Nov 10 23:18:56 paveljanik Panther has problems with localization etc.
Nov 10 23:19:16 paveljanik and we want to have the same baseline on both PPC and Intel ;-)
Nov 10 23:19:41 paveljanik the last argument is the most important (at least for me)
Nov 10 23:20:15 ericb2 ok, last Pantehr version will be 2.1
Nov 10 23:20:32 ericb2 last but not least, Aqua version is not 10.3 compatible
Nov 10 23:20:44 obr we might add that we think Panther is no longer used widely
Nov 10 23:20:47 ericb2 because of some changes Christian Lippka did
Nov 10 23:20:49 mav_eric_ ericb2: so two important points.
Nov 10 23:21:14 tino I have to wrap up. cu later, good night!
Nov 10 23:21:18 ericb2 and maintain everything eats a lot of resources, needs harware ..etc
Nov 10 23:21:20 mav_eric_ 1. Aqua build - once it is out - is 10.3.x incompatible and 2. same baseline for both PPC and Intel
